Who owns the Denver Broncos?
The Denver Broncos are currently owned by the Walton-Penner family ownership group, led by Walmart heir Rob Walton. The group purchased the NFL franchise in 2022 for a record-breaking sum of $4.65 billion, making it the most expensive sports team sale in history at the time.
How many Super Bowls have the Denver Broncos won?
The Broncos have won three Super Bowl titles in their franchise history. Their victories came in Super Bowl XXXII and Super Bowl XXXIII following the 1997 and 1998 seasons with John Elway and Terrell Davis, and Super Bowl 50 following the 2015 season with Peyton Manning.
What is the name of the Denver Broncos' home stadium?
The team plays its home games at Empower Field at Mile High, located in Denver, Colorado. The stadium adopted this name in 2019 after a naming rights deal with Empower Retirement, though it is still widely referred to by locals simply as Mile High.
When were the Denver Broncos founded?
The franchise was officially founded on August 14, 1959, when Bob Howsam was awarded an American Football League (AFL) charter team. They began their inaugural professional play in 1960 before eventually joining the NFL during the AFL-NFL merger.
